Job Description and Duties:
Pre-Operative Duties
Effectively organizes time, equipment, supplies, and personnelUses equipment effectively by anticipating patient needs and providing appropriate careConfirms that proper techniques and procedures are used according to accepted standards of practiceAssists in the inventory of supplies, drugs, and equipment to maintain availability and stock levels in the preoperative areaMaintains order and cleanliness of the preoperative areaPerforms thorough preoperative patient assessment required in the outpatient settingAssists in assessing the physical and emotional status of the patient prior to admissionProvides preoperative instruction and explanation of patient rights and responsibilitiesDescribes the perioperative experience to the patient/significant other, including what to expect before, during, and after the procedure, and how the significant other will participateObtains pertinent patient records prior to patient's arrival for preoperative testingPerforms all preoperative testing (i.e., laboratory work, electrocardiogram, x-rays, etc.)Reports all abnormal values to the anesthesiologist/attending surgeonExplains informed consent for surgery, patients' rights/responsibilities, and preoperative/postoperative instructionsObtains necessary signaturesInforms patient about routine care and procedures related to the perioperative experienceDiscusses all findings with the anesthesiologist prior to the anesthesiologist's preoperative evaluation of patientProvides comfort and reassurance to the patient and supports the patient's right to privacy, dignity, and confidentialityDocuments preoperative care according to policy/procedureEnsures that the patient's chart is complete on the day before surgery is scheduledRecovery Duties
